-
OpenCV फ़ंक्शन का उपयोग करके एक वृत्त बनाएं सर्कल ()
इस लेख में, हम OpenCV फ़ंक्शन सर्कल () का उपयोग करके एक छवि पर एक वृत्त खींचेंगे। मूल चित्र एल्गोरिदम Step 1: Import OpenCV. Step 2: Define the radius of circle. Step 3: Define the center coordinates of the circle. Step 4: Define the color of the circle. Step 5: Define the thickness. Step 6: Pass
-
OpenCV फ़ंक्शन fillPoly () का उपयोग करके एक भरा हुआ बहुभुज बनाएं
इस कार्यक्रम में, हम opencv फ़ंक्शन fillPoly () का उपयोग करके एक भरे हुए बहुभुज को आकर्षित करेंगे। फ़ंक्शन बहुभुज की एक छवि और समापन बिंदु लेता है। एल्गोरिदम Step 1: Import cv2 and numpy. Step 2: Define the endpoints. Step 3: Define the image using zeros. Step 4: Draw the polygon using the fillpoly(
-
फ़ंक्शन putText () का उपयोग करके ओपनसीवी विंडो पर टेक्स्ट प्रदर्शित करें
इस प्रोग्राम में, हम opencv फंक्शन putText () का उपयोग करके इमेज पर टेक्स्ट लिखेंगे। यह फ़ंक्शन छवि, फ़ॉन्ट, पाठ, रंग, मोटाई आदि को कहां रखना है, इसके निर्देशांक लेता है। मूल चित्र एल्गोरिदम चरण 1:आयात cv2चरण 2:puttext ( ) फ़ंक्शन के लिए पैरामीटर परिभाषित करें। चरण 3:पैरामीटर को puttext() फ़ंक्शन
-
OpenCV फ़ंक्शन का उपयोग करके छवि को धुंधला करना धुंधला ()
इस प्रोग्राम में, हम opencv फंक्शन ब्लर () का उपयोग करके एक इमेज को ब्लर करेंगे। एल्गोरिदम Step 1: Import OpenCV. Step 2: Import the image. Step 3: Set the kernel size. Step 4: Call the blur() function and pass the image and kernel size as parameters. Step 5: Display the results. मूल चित्र उदाहरण
-
OpenCV फ़ंक्शन गॉसियन ब्लर () का उपयोग करके एक छवि को धुंधला करना
इस कार्यक्रम में, OpenCV फ़ंक्शन GaussianBlur () का उपयोग करके एक छवि को धुंधला कर देगा। गॉसियन ब्लर गाऊसी फ़ंक्शन का उपयोग करके एक छवि को धुंधला करने की प्रक्रिया है। यह छवि से शोर को दूर करने और विवरण को कम करने के लिए ग्राफिक्स सॉफ़्टवेयर में व्यापक रूप से उपयोग किया जाता है। एल्गोरिदम Step 1: Im
-
लेजेंड में केवल कुछ आइटम दिखाएं Python Matplotlib
plt.legend() का उपयोग करके, हम केवल सूची में मान डालकर कुछ आइटम जोड़ या दिखा सकते हैं। कदम plt.xlabel() विधि का उपयोग करके X-अक्ष लेबल सेट करें। plt.ylabel() विधि का उपयोग करके Y-अक्ष लेबल सेट करें। प्लॉट () विधि तर्क में पारित सूचियों का उपयोग करके लाइनों को प्लॉट करें। स्थान और लेजेंड_
-
OpenCV फ़ंक्शन का उपयोग करके एक छवि को धुंधला करना medianBlur ()
इस कार्यक्रम में, हम OpenCV लाइब्रेरी में मेडियनब्लूर () फ़ंक्शन का उपयोग करके छवि को धुंधला कर देंगे। मीडियन धुंधलापन शोर को दूर करते हुए एक छवि में किनारों को संसाधित करने में मदद करता है। मूल चित्र एल्गोरिदम Step 1: Import cv2. Step 2: Read the image. Step 3: Pass image and kernel size in the c
-
OpenCV फ़ंक्शन का उपयोग करके एक छवि को मिटाना ()
इस कार्यक्रम में, हम OpenCV फ़ंक्शन इरोड () का उपयोग करके एक छवि को मिटा देंगे। छवि के क्षरण का अर्थ है छवि को सिकोड़ना। यदि कर्नेल में कोई भी पिक्सेल 0 है, तो कर्नेल के सभी पिक्सेल 0 पर सेट हो जाते हैं। छवि पर क्षरण फ़ंक्शन लागू करने से पहले एक शर्त यह है कि छवि एक ग्रेस्केल छवि होनी चाहिए। मूल चित
-
OpenCV फ़ंक्शन का उपयोग करके छवियों को पतला करना
इस कार्यक्रम में, हम OpenCV लाइब्रेरी में डाइलेट फ़ंक्शन का उपयोग करके एक छवि को फैलाएंगे। Dilation एक छवि में वस्तुओं की सीमाओं में पिक्सेल जोड़ता है, यानी, यह छवि को सभी तरफ फैलाता है। मूल चित्र एल्गोरिदम Step 1: Import cv2 and numpy. Step 2: Read the image using opencv.imread(). Step 3: Define
-
पायथन के Matplotlib के साथ एक्स-अक्ष पर प्लॉटिंग तिथियां
पंडों का उपयोग करके, हम एक डेटाफ़्रेम बना सकते हैं और डेटाटाइम के लिए इंडेक्स सेट कर सकते हैं। gcf().autofmt_xdate() का उपयोग करके, हम दिनांक को X-अक्ष पर समायोजित करेंगे। कदम date_time की सूची बनाएं और pd.to_datetime() का उपयोग करके date_time में उसमें कनवर्ट करें। डेटा पर विचार करें =[1, 2,
-
OpenCV का उपयोग करके एक छवि पर एक उद्घाटन ऑपरेशन करना
इस प्रोग्राम में हम इमेज पर ओपनिंग ऑपरेशन करेंगे। ओपनिंग छोटी वस्तुओं को छवि के अग्रभूमि से हटाता है, उन्हें पृष्ठभूमि में रखता है। इस तकनीक का उपयोग किसी छवि में विशिष्ट आकृतियों को खोजने के लिए भी किया जा सकता है। उद्घाटन को कटाव के बाद फैलाव कहा जा सकता है। इस कार्य के लिए हम जिस फ़ंक्शन का उपयोग
-
OpenCV का उपयोग करके किसी छवि पर समापन ऑपरेशन करना
इस कार्यक्रम में, हम cv2.morphologyEx () फ़ंक्शन का उपयोग करके समापन ऑपरेशन करेंगे। क्लोजिंग अग्रभूमि में छोटे छिद्रों को हटाता है, पृष्ठभूमि के छोटे छिद्रों को अग्रभूमि में बदल देता है। इस तकनीक का उपयोग किसी छवि में विशिष्ट आकृतियों को खोजने के लिए भी किया जा सकता है। इस कार्य के लिए हम जिस फ़ंक्श
-
पिलो लाइब्रेरी का उपयोग करके किसी छवि में प्रत्येक बैंड के लिए सभी पिक्सेल के माध्यिका की गणना करना
इस कार्यक्रम में, हम पिलो लाइब्रेरी का उपयोग करके प्रत्येक चैनल में सभी पिक्सेल के माध्यिका की गणना करेंगे। एक इमेज में कुल 3 चैनल होते हैं और इसलिए हमें तीन मानों की एक सूची मिलेगी। मूल चित्र एल्गोरिदम Step 1: Import the Image and ImageStat libraries. Step 2: Open the image. Step 3: Pass the imag
-
पायथन Matplotlib में संख्याओं को घातीय रूप में बदलने से कैसे रोकें?
टिकलेबल_फॉर्मैट () पद्धति में शैली =सादा का उपयोग करके, हम मूल्य को घातीय रूप में परिवर्तित कर सकते हैं। कदम प्लॉट () पद्धति का उपयोग करके एक रेखा खींचने के लिए दो सूचियाँ पास करें। शैली =सादा के साथ ticklabel_format () विधि का प्रयोग करें। यदि कोई पैरामीटर सेट नहीं है, तो फ़ॉर्मेटर की संबंधित
-
व्यक्तिगत फ्रेम को फाइलों में सहेजे बिना पायथन से एक फिल्म बनाना
FuncAnimation विधि का उपयोग करके, हम एक फिल्म बना सकते हैं। हम कणों की स्थिति को बदलते रहने के लिए एक उपयोगकर्ता-परिभाषित विधि, अपडेट बनाएंगे और अंत में, विधि स्कैटर इंस्टेंस को वापस कर देगी। कदम कणों की प्रारंभिक स्थिति, वेग, बल और आकार प्राप्त करें। एक नया आंकड़ा बनाएं, या मौजूदा आंकड़े को f
-
Python में TeX के साथ Matplotlib लेबल में एक नई लाइन डालना
निम्न प्रोग्राम कोड दिखाता है कि आप टेक्स के साथ matplotlib लेबल में एक नई लाइन कैसे प्लॉट कर सकते हैं। कदम आरेख के लिए X-अक्ष और Y-अक्ष लेबल को \n के साथ सेटअप करें ताकि लेबल में एक नई पंक्ति बनाई जा सके। कुल्हाड़ियों के चेहरे के रंग के लिए वर्तमान .rcParams सेट करें; समूह को हटा दिया गया है।
-
OpenCV का उपयोग करके छवियों पर सफेद TopHat संचालन करना
इस कार्यक्रम में, हम छवियों पर TopHat संचालन करेंगे। TopHat ऑपरेशन एक रूपात्मक ऑपरेशन है जिसका उपयोग दी गई छवियों से छोटे तत्वों और विवरणों को निकालने के लिए किया जाता है। TopHat का उपयोग गहरे रंग की पृष्ठभूमि में चमकदार वस्तुओं को बढ़ाने के लिए किया जाता है। हम आकृति विज्ञान का उपयोग करेंगेEx(image
-
OpenCV का उपयोग करके छवियों पर सफेद ब्लैकहैट ऑपरेशन करना
इस कार्यक्रम में, हम OpenCV का उपयोग करके एक छवि पर ब्लैकहैट ऑपरेशन करेंगे। ब्लैकहैट ट्रांसफॉर्म का उपयोग चमकदार पृष्ठभूमि में रुचि की डार्क ऑब्जेक्ट्स को बढ़ाने के लिए किया जाता है। हम आकृति विज्ञानEx(image, cv2.MORPH_BLACKHAT, कर्नेल) फ़ंक्शन का उपयोग करेंगे। मूल चित्र एल्गोरिदम उदाहरण कोड आयात
-
OpenCV का उपयोग करके एक छवि का अपसैंपलिंग
इस कार्यक्रम में, हम एक छवि का नमूना लेंगे। अप सैंपलिंग एक छवि के 2डी प्रतिनिधित्व को रखते हुए स्थानिक संकल्प को बढ़ा रहा है। यह आमतौर पर किसी छवि के एक छोटे से क्षेत्र पर ज़ूम इन करने के लिए उपयोग किया जाता है। हम इस कार्य को पूरा करने के लिए ओपनसीवी लाइब्रेरी में pyrup () फ़ंक्शन का उपयोग करेंगे।
-
कैसे अजगर में pylab के साथ दूर से एक आंकड़ा बचाने के लिए?
पाइप्लॉट पैकेज की सेवफिग विधि का उपयोग करके, हम फिगर की लोकेशन निर्दिष्ट करके फिगर को दूर से सेव कर सकते हैं। कदम किसी भिन्न बैकएंड का उपयोग करने के लिए, इसे matplotlib.use(Agg) विधि का उपयोग करके सेट करें। प्लॉट () विधि का उपयोग करके लाइनों को प्लॉट करें। savefig () विधि का उपयोग करके, हम